Caroline Lutz advises clients on a variety of commercial real estate transactions, including acquisitions and dispositions, development, and leasing transactions. Caroline has extensive experience representing clients with respect to triple-net lease acquisitions, providing thorough and succinct analysis on various leasing, title and survey, and other issues that are unique to each transaction. Additionally, she also advises clients within the REIT industry with respect to servicing, property management, and other landlord/tenant matters for both single-tenant and multi-tenant assets.
